Specifications
| Spec | Magcubic Mini Projector with WiFi 6 and Bluetooth 5.4 | DreamFair Mini Projector, Support 4K 1080P Portable |
|---|---|---|
| Resolution | 720P with 4K support | 1280*720 |
| Contrast Ratio | 8000:1 | 10,000:1 |
| Bluetooth | 5.4 | 5.2 |
| Screen Size | 80" | 35"-130" |
| Keystone Correction | Auto | Auto + Manual |

Image Quality
When it comes to image quality, the Magcubic Mini Projector offers a brightness of 8000 lumens and an impressive contrast ratio of 8000:1, making it suitable for casual movie watching and gaming. In contrast, the Mini Projector boasts 200 ANSI lumens with a 10,000:1 contrast ratio, which, while lower in brightness, still supports 4K and 1080P video resolutions. This highlights that while the Magcubic model excels in brightness, the DreamFair projector also provides decent quality for its price, appealing to those who prioritize resolution over sheer brightness.
Sound Features
The Magcubic Mini Projector includes a 5W SoundBase Speaker, delivering a rich audio experience that eliminates the need for external speakers. On the other hand, the Mini Projector also has a built-in speaker but relies on Bluetooth 5.4 technology to connect to external audio devices for enhanced sound. This means that while the Magcubic offers a more integrated solution, the Mini Projector provides flexibility for users who prefer to customize their audio experience.
Portability
In terms of portability, both projectors are designed to be lightweight and adaptable for various settings. The Magcubic Mini Projector weighs only 0.88 pounds and can be easily mounted or placed in different orientations, including a 180-degree rotation feature. The Mini Projector also claims to be portable with a rotatable design and an optimal projection distance of 5.51 feet. Both projectors are suitable for home use or outdoor activities, although the Magcubic's lighter weight may provide a slight edge in convenience.
Connectivity Options
Connectivity features set these two projectors apart significantly. The Magcubic Mini Projector excels with WiFi 6 and Bluetooth 5.4, allowing seamless access to a vast library of content without the need for additional devices. Conversely, the Mini Projector also supports dual-band WiFi 6, but it emphasizes ease of connection to smartphones and laptops in just five seconds. This quick connection feature may appeal to users who prioritize speed and efficiency over a broader app ecosystem.
User Experience
The user experience is another area where the Magcubic Mini Projector stands out, thanks to its advanced Air Mouse remote that supports voice commands for hands-free operation. This feature provides precise control and ease of navigation between apps and settings. The Mini Projector, while offering automatic keystone correction and manual focus, lacks a similarly sophisticated remote option. This may influence users who value intuitive control in their projector experience.
